Sindh Governor Tessori to Distribute Free Mobile Phones on Independence Day

KARACHI: Sindh Governor Kamran Tessori has announced plans to distribute free mobile phones and other prizes to the public on the occasion of Independence Day. Speaking to media representatives, the Governor detailed a series of grand celebrations, ensuring that this year’s festivities will be memorable.

Governor Tessori emphasized that a ‘comprehensive’ security plan has been devised for the event, ensuring the safety of the large crowd expected to attend. Additionally, a traffic plan will be uploaded on social media before the event to facilitate smooth travel for attendees.

One of the highlights of the celebrations will be the largest fireworks display in the country’s history, set to take place at the Governor’s House. A special team has arrived from Dubai to execute this spectacular show.

In a special announcement, Governor Tessori revealed that Olympic gold medalist Arshad Nadeem will be a guest of honor at the Governor’s House, arriving on a special invitation. The festivities will also feature performances by renowned singer Atif Aslam and other artists.

The Governor’s House will be open to the public, with an expected turnout of 500,000 people. Additionally, Bagh-e-Jinnah, located adjacent to the Governor’s House, will also be opened to the public for the celebrations. Large screens will be installed from Fawara Chowk to Shaheen Complex to ensure that everyone can enjoy the events.

Governor Tessori’s announcements have set high expectations for a day filled with national pride and entertainment as Karachi prepares to celebrate Independence Day with unmatched enthusiasm.

It is pertinent to mention that Governor Tessori previously promised new smartphones to everyone who lost their mobile phones during incidents of street crime in Karachi over the past year. However, street crime has been on the rise, coinciding with increasing unemployment and inflation in Pakistan.

While the government appears comfortable spending millions of rupees on Independence Day celebrations, the public continues to seek relief from the burden of rising electricity bills.
